We can understand a mother's love for her children, the husband and wife's love for
each other and our love for our brothers and sisters in Christ. But, how can we
understand why God would love us as sinners and enemies against His? In this passage
we see some of the greatest blessings that could ever be given to anyone.
I. We Are Chosen (1:4)
- In Christ (In the merit of another)
- Before the foundation of the world (Grace)
- To be holy and without blame in live (Purpose)
II. We Are Predestined
- To the Adoption of Children (vs 5; Galatians 4:1-7)
- To an Inheritance (vs 11)
- To the Image of His Son (Romans 8:29-30)
- His Image (Galatians 5:22-23)
- We shall be like Him (1 John 3:1-3)
III. We Are Accepted (1:6-8)
- As a result of His Redemption (1 Peter 1:18-20; Romans 3:24-26)
- As a result of His Righteousness (Romans 3:26)
Conclusion
--We are secure in His Love (Romans 8:31-39)
